Clann ready for action

April 11, 2018

Clann nan Gael manager Fergal Shine admits that it is a little strange preparing for the opening round of the Roscommon SFC in April.

The former kingpins face the current kingpins as Clann take on defending champions St Brigid's in this weekend's first round clash.

They could not have asked for a tougher opener, but Shine told the Westmeath Independent that they have been working hard for this game.

"It's a little strange to think we are preparing for the club championship in the second week of April. It's a new experience for everyone involved," said Shine.

"It is hard to gauge where we are in terms of our preparation. We were beaten in our last league game so from that point of view, we were a little disappointed with how we performed in that game."

He added: "We are confident in our own ability and I expect this game to go down to the wire. St Brigid's are the title holders they have an array of talent in their starting 15 so it goes without saying we are expecting a very tough challenge."
